[Seasar-user:11539] Re: requiresNewTxにてcommit時に例外が発生した場合にRollbackされない
鈴木 順
[E-MAIL ADDRESS DELETED]
2007年 11月 8日 (木) 14:31:13 JST
小林さん
お世話になっております。鈴木です。
>
> この辺りに LocalTransaction と出てること.
> GlobalTransaction とかになるはずじゃないかと
> 思うのですが.
> XA ではない DataSource が使われてないでしょうか?
> であれば,新しい requiresNew なトランザクションに
> 切り替えられないのも辻褄は合いそう.
> 念のため,データソースの設定を見直しをお願いします.
>
> 他に考えられるのは required なトランザクションが
> グローバルトランザクションになってないことですが,
> こちらはもう少し調べてみます.
>
>
確認しましたが管理コンソール上はXAになっております。
「oracle.jdbc.xa.client.OracleXADataSource」を使うようになっております。
一応画像を添付します。
他に必要な情報があればこちらで取得しますが、なにかありますでしょうか?
以上
-------------- next part --------------
テキスト形式以外の添付ファイルを保管しました...
ファイル名: c2.GIF
型: image/gif
サイズ: 22394 バイト
説明: 無し
URL: http://ml.seasar.org/archives/seasar-user/attachments/20071108/196286e7/attachment.gif
-------------- next part --------------
テキスト形式以外の添付ファイルを保管しました...
ファイル名: c1.GIF
型: image/gif
サイズ: 49929 バイト
説明: 無し
URL: http://ml.seasar.org/archives/seasar-user/attachments/20071108/196286e7/attachment-0001.gif
Seasar-user メーリングリストの案内